Digoxin is used for:
Treating heart failure and slowing the heart rate in patients with chronic atrial fibrillation, a type of abnormal heart rhythm. It may also be used for other conditions as determined by your doctor.
Digoxin is a digitalis glycoside. It works by increasing the force of contraction of the heart and slowing heart rate.
Do NOT use Digoxin if:
- you are allergic to any ingredient in Digoxin or other digitalis medicines
- you have beriberi heart disease
- you have certain types of heart rhythm problems, such as ventricular fibrillation
Contact your doctor or health care provider right away if any of these apply to you.
How to use Digoxin :
Use Digoxin as directed by your doctor. Check the label on the medicine for exact dosing instructions.
- Digoxin is usually given as an injection at your doctor's office, hospital, or clinic. If you will be using Digoxin at home, a health care provider will teach you how to use it. Be sure you understand how to use Digoxin . Follow the procedures you are taught when you use a dose. Contact your health care provider if you have any questions.
- Do not use Digoxin if it contains particles, is cloudy or discolored, or if the vial is cracked or damaged.
- Keep this product, as well as syringes and needles, out of the reach of children and pets. Do not reuse needles, syringes, or other materials. Ask your health care provider how to dispose of these materials after use. Follow all local rules for disposal.
- If you miss a dose of Digoxin , take it as soon as possible. If it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and go back to your regular dosing schedule. Do not take 2 doses at once.
Ask your health care provider any questions you may have about how to use Digoxin .
